Details of the Hike

Years 2005 and 2006: hiked (on day hikes) from Puerto Morelos to Playa Del Carmen, about 40 miles.
Year 2007: Paa Mul (just below Playa del Carmen/XCaret) to Tulum (about 120 miles in 8 days) Year 2008: Tulum to Santa Rosa Island (about 100 miles in 8 days)
Year 2009: Punta Pulticub (part of Punta Herrero coast) to Punta Kanechaxh (120 miles)
Year 2010 (May): Punta Kanechaxh to San Pedro Belize (100 miles?)

We hike about 15-20 miles a day. When we need to get to the area where we left off the previous year, we always travel like the locals: using collectivos, hitch hiking, riding in back of pick up trucks or chicken buses. I like to practice my Spanish, it is cheaper, exciting, and adventurous!
